In the field of physics, particularly in optics, the term coherent optics refers to the study and application of light waves that are in phase with one another. This coherence is essential for various optical phenomena and technologies. To understand coherent optics, it is crucial to first grasp the concept of coherence itself. Coherence describes the correlation between the phases of waves at different points in space and time. Light waves can be classified as coherent or incoherent based on their phase relationship. Coherent light sources, such as lasers, emit light waves that have a constant phase difference, making them highly organized and predictable.The significance of coherent optics lies in its applications across numerous fields, including telecommunications, imaging systems, and quantum mechanics. For instance, in telecommunications, coherent optical communication systems utilize coherent optics to transmit data over long distances with minimal loss. By employing techniques such as phase modulation, these systems can achieve higher data rates and improved signal quality compared to traditional methods.Moreover, coherent optics plays a pivotal role in advanced imaging techniques. Techniques like holography rely on the principles of coherent optics to create three-dimensional images by recording light patterns from coherent sources. Holography has applications in security, data storage, and even art. The ability to manipulate coherent light allows for the creation of realistic representations of objects, enhancing our understanding of the physical world.In addition to telecommunications and imaging, coherent optics is integral to the field of quantum mechanics. Quantum optics, which studies the interaction of light with matter at the quantum level, often involves coherent light sources. Experiments that explore quantum entanglement and superposition frequently utilize coherent optics to manipulate and measure quantum states. This intersection of light and quantum theory opens new avenues for research and technology, such as quantum computing and secure communication channels.Furthermore, the development of new materials and technologies continues to enhance the capabilities of coherent optics. Innovations in photonic devices, such as waveguides and optical fibers, have improved the efficiency and performance of coherent systems. As researchers explore new ways to generate and control coherent light, the potential applications seem limitless.
